Key Responsibilities:
The Virtualization & Cloud Automation Engineer is responsible for engineering, automating, and supporting the organization's hybrid infrastructure across VMware Cloud Foundation (VCF), Microsoft Azure, enterprise container platforms, and Cisco UCS compute environments. This role combines deep technical knowledge of virtualization, cloud services, automation frameworks, and container orchestration with strong security awareness, documentation discipline, and cross-team collaboration.
Key Responsibilities:
- Manage and optimize VMware Cloud Foundation (VCF) 9.x, including vSphere, vSAN, NSX, and SDDC Manager.
- Perform lifecycle operations: patching, upgrades, performance tuning, and capacity planning.
- Troubleshoot ESXi hosts, NSX overlays, vCenter services, and distributed virtualization components.
- Administer Azure IaaS/PaaS including VMs, VNets, Storage, Key Vault, Azure Monitor, and governance tooling.
- Implement Azure governance such as RBAC, Azure Policy, tagging and cost-control practices.
- Deploy/manage Docker, Kubernetes, AKS, and Tanzu Kubernetes Grid clusters.
- Maintain container cluster health, networking, storage classes, registries, and workload orchestration.
- Develop automation using PowerShell, Python, Terraform, Azure CLI, and Bicep.
- Build IaC modules, reusable automation, CI/CD pipelines, and provisioning workflows.
- Administer Cisco UCS blades, service profiles, fabric interconnects, and firmware lifecycles.
- Participate in on-call rotation to provide after-hours support and incident response.
- Serve as a Tier-3 escalation point for virtualization, cloud, automation, and container issues.
- Apply zero-trust-aligned configuration principles and secure infrastructure practices.
- Monitor health, logs, alerts, risk events, and performance indicators across hybrid-cloud systems.
- Support incident response, environment hardening, and infrastructure compliance efforts.
- Maintain documentation: runbooks, architecture diagrams, operational standards, and procedures.
- Support business continuity, high-availability engineering, and DR validation processes.
- Ensure secure lifecycle processes including patching, certificate hygiene, and least-privilege alignment.
